Output abd8bc45843f165a29f50e314792fe7797f24826fcacc3360e6c2dfc2d0ec6cc:23

value
809727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c74cde68fe60e240f3dda58410451cc97566a94 OP_EQUAL
address
3BaUpy1LsB3FM5JEs5E8mWKvqPSECu1eBF
transaction
abd8bc45843f165a29f50e314792fe7797f24826fcacc3360e6c2dfc2d0ec6cc
confirmations
156356
spent
true